Dept. of Transportation The Utah State Archives was created to help state agencies and local governments manage their records as well as to care for government documents with historical value. The archives holds records from Utah's earliest territorial days to current records created by modern government agencies. Both state and local government records, along with. Public records with historical value have been collected since 1917. In July 1894, the U.S. Congress enacted a law to enable the territory of Utah to be admitted into the Union as a state. The act spelled out the calling of a convention composed of 107 delegates to meet beginning in March 1895 to draw up a state constitution. These records are the papers of that.

The Utah State Archives is the repository for many judicial/court records, including the Utah State Supreme Court and many county district courts. Records of municipal courts and justice courts are housed here also. Starting in 1790, federal population schedules were taken every 10 years in the United States. Click here for more information about federal census records. Utah was admitted to the Union as the 45th state on 4 Jan 1896. It was not included in federal censuses before that date. Birth records are public after 100 years. Death records are public after 50 years. Marriage and divorce records are public after 75 years. The Government Records Access and Management Act (GRAMA) is a comprehensive state law that deals with the management of government records. The law outlines exactly who has access to specific records while detailing the process for requesting such information. GRAMA is an attempt to balance the public's constitutional right of access to information regarding government conduct.

The Utah State Records Committee was established by the Utah Government Records Access and Management Act in order to better assist the state in enforcing the open records act by approving records retention and disposal schedules and holding hearings to decide appeals for records requests..
